Preheat the oven to 375 degrees. Line baking sheet with aluminum foil. Slice the bread lengthwise, using a serrated knife. Then place the bread on the baking sheet, cut side up.
Now in a food processor add the softened butter, oil, salt, pepper, parsley, and mix until blended.
Spread the garlic butter spread on the bread in an even layer.
Then sprinkle the garlic bread with the shredded mozzarella and grated parmesan.
Bake for 10 minutes or until the edges of the garlic bread until crispy and cheese is melted.
Remove the bread from the oven, let it cool, and then slice and serve.

Air Fryer Directions: Place the garlic bread in the air fryer, and cook at 350 degrees, and air fry for 5 minutes and check. Then cook another 3-5 minutes or until the bread is crispy and done. Bread - I used French bread, or you can reach for Texas toast or another cut of bread. Storage - Store the leftover bread in an airtight container in the fridge. To reheat you will warm in the microwave, or back in the oven. The oven will give the bread a crispy texture. Freezing Bread - You can freeze the bread before you bake it. Wrap in aluminum foil then place in an airtight container. Then place on baking sheet and cook from frozen, just add a few extra minutes for cooking. Garlic Butter Spread - if you have leftover garlic butter spread, store in an airtight container in the fridge. Mix in vegetables, top steak, pair with chicken for seasoning, etc. You can use the garlic butter for anything.
